Philippine National Bank's customer loan growth reached 20.2% in 2018, up from 16.2% compared to the previous year. Historically, the bank’s loans growth reached an all time high of 109% in 2013 and an all time low of -29.3% in 2006. In the last decade, the average annual loan growth amounted to 21.8%.
On the other hand, bank's customer deposit growth amounted to 15.0% at the end of 2018, up from 11.8% when compared to the previous year. Historically, the bank’s deposit growth reached an all time high of 91.9% in 2013 and an all time low of -27.6% in 2000. In the last decade, the average annual loan growth amounted to 13.8%.
At the end of 2018, Philippine National Bank's loans accounted for 75.9% of total deposits and 56.6% of total assets.
